Restart Log

The sysinfo Group of the Allied Telesis Enterprise MIB has the object identifier
prefix sysinfo ({ enterprises(1) alliedTelesyn(207) mibObject(8) brouterMib(4)
atRouter(4) 3 }), and contains objects that describe generic system information.
This software version defines the following new object in the sysinfo Group:
restartLog ({ sysinfo 11 }) contains the log messages of type REST/001
generated during the last restart.

Trap on Login Failures

The TTY Group of the Allied Telesis Enterprise MIB has the object identifier
prefix tty ({ enterprises(1) alliedTelesyn(207) mibObject(8) brouterMib(4)
atRouter(4) modules(4) 36 }), and contains objects and a trap for monitoring
login failures.
This software version defines the following new objects and trap in the
ttyTraps ({ tty 100 }) subtree:
loginFailureUser ({ ttyTraps 1 }) is the username that generated the login
failure.
loginFailureIPAddress ({ ttyTraps 2 }) is the IP address the failed login
attempt originated from.
loginFailureAttempts ({ ttyTraps 3 }) is the number of failed login attempts.
The loginFailureTrap trap ({ ttyTraps 11 }) is generated when a user is
locked out because the number of consecutive failed login attempts
exceeded the maximum allowed, and contains the following objects:
loginFailureUser
loginFailureIPAddress
loginFailureAttempts

VLAN-based port state changes

The Switch Group of the Allied Telesis Enterprise MIB has the object identifier
prefix swi ({ enterprises(1) alliedTelesyn(207) mibObject(8) brouterMib(4)
atRouter(4) modules(4) 87 }), and objects that describe switch ports.
This software version defines the following new objects and trap in the Switch
Group:
swiPortVlanTable ({ swi 4 }) is a table of port/VLAN mappings, indexed
by swiPortVlanPortNumber and swiPortVlanVlanId. It contains the
following objects:
swiPortVlanPortNumber, the index of a port on the router or switch.
